We Have Blueprint to Revamp Nigeria’s Economy, Guarantee Security – APM

The Allied People’s Movement (APM), said it has developed a pragmatic wide-ranging governance blueprint to swiftly resuscitate the productive sector, rebuild critical infrastructure, revamp the ailing economy, pull the nation from the brinks of collapse and restore dignity and comfort to the lives of all citizens.

The National Publicity Secretary of APM, Hon. Abubakar Yusuf in a statement said the blueprint will also reshape the nation’s broken security architecture and effectively check acts of terrorism and guarantee the security of lives and property across the country.

APM alleged that the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) in the last 10 years, especially the last, governed Nigeria without a coherent economic blueprint resulting in a totally confused, careless and rudderless governance, characterized by massive corruption and reckless anti-people policies.

This, the opposition party said  led to biting economic hardship, hyper-unemployment, skyrocketing inflation, collapsed infrastructure and widespread insecurity.

“Largely due to APC government’s failures, in the last three years alone, official and independent reports indicate that no fewer than 628,000 Nigerians have been killed with over 2.2 million others including children and women abducted. Poverty rate has hit a staggering 63% with over 33.3% unemployment rate. More than 140 million Nigerians now live below the national poverty line.

“Due to worsening insecurity, collapsed public service and economic inflation exacerbated by unhealthy taxes and tariffs, major multinationals have been exiting our nation in droves. Over 3.7 million Nigerian youths and professionals have fled the country in what is now known as the “Japa” phenomenon resulting in the worst brain drain ever, especially in our education and health sectors.

“We in the APM are concerned that despite Nigeria’s vast resources and large population, poverty, unemployment and inflation continue to rise. The cost of basic commodities and services have become increasingly unaffordable with many families in distress and cannot afford their daily meals and other basic necessities of life.

 

“More distressing is that the future of over 250 million Nigerians is being mortgaged to foreign interests by the APC through reckless borrowings which has hit a frightening N159.28 trillion, with nothing on ground to show as most of the proceeds are reported to have been diverted to private purses.

“Today, our nation is in dire straits. Nigerians are heavily frustrated, agitated over bad leadership and earnestly seek for a new beginning. It is clear that the APM, with its ideological base, structure and composition, is the only platform that embodies that solution and new beginning.

 

 

“The APM blueprint is service oriented, forward looking and tailored to put Nigerians back to work, attract Foreign Direct Investment and boost private sector productivity through strategic investments in critical sectors including oil and gas, power, electricity, agriculture and food production; manufacturing, education, housing, healthcare among others,” the statement noted.

 

It assured Nigerians that at the right time, the comprehensive blueprint will be unveiled as the APM is poised to democratically take over the helm of affairs of our country in 2027.

 

“In government, the APM will be a listening party, committed to transparency, good governance, social justice, adherence to the Rule of Law, freedom of speech, respect for the right of citizens and overall well-being of all Nigerians,” the party added.
